- The distance between Pocahontas, Ar, Usa and San, Mali is approximately 8,802 km or 5,469 mi.
- To reach Pocahontas, Ar in this distance one would set out from San bearing 304.7°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Pocahontas, Ar bearing 261.3° or W .
- Pocahontas, Ar has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as San has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Pocahontas, Ar is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as San is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 12.8 °C (23°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.2 °C (29.2°F) more in Pocahontas, Ar.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 556.8 mm (21.9 in) more which is equivalent to 556.8 l/m² (13.67 US gal/ft²) or 5,568,000 l/ha (595,256 US gal/ac) more. About 1 4/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18.5° lower in Pocahontas, Ar than in San.
